[Checkins] SVN: buildout-website/trunk/source/ A new theme based on default theme

Baiju M baiju.m.mail at gmail.com
Thu Apr 23 14:17:06 EDT 2009


Log message for revision 99433:
  A new theme based on default theme
  

Changed:
  D   buildout-website/trunk/source/_static/default.css_t
  A   buildout-website/trunk/source/buildout_theme2/
  A   buildout-website/trunk/source/buildout_theme2/static/
  A   buildout-website/trunk/source/buildout_theme2/static/buildout.css_t
  A   buildout-website/trunk/source/buildout_theme2/theme.conf

-=-
Deleted: buildout-website/trunk/source/_static/default.css_t
===================================================================
--- buildout-website/trunk/source/_static/default.css_t	2009-04-23 16:52:46 UTC (rev 99432)
+++ buildout-website/trunk/source/_static/default.css_t	2009-04-23 18:17:05 UTC (rev 99433)
@@ -1,351 +0,0 @@
-/**
- * Sphinx stylesheet -- default theme
- * 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
- */
-
- at import url("basic.css");
-
-/* -- page layout ----------------------------------------------------------- */
-
-body {
-    font-family: {{ theme_bodyfont }};
-    font-size: 100%;
-    background-color: {{ theme_footerbgcolor }};
-    color: #000;
-    margin: 0;
-    padding: 0;
-}
-
-div.document {
-    background-color: {{ theme_sidebarbgcolor }};
-}
-
-div.body {
-    background-color: {{ theme_bgcolor }};
-    color: {{ theme_textcolor }};
-    padding: 0 20px 30px 20px;
-}
-
-{%- if theme_rightsidebar|tobool %}
-div.bodywrapper {
-    margin: 0 230px 0 0;
-}
-{%- endif %}
-
-div.footer {
-    color: {{ theme_footertextcolor }};
-    width: 100%;
-    padding: 9px 0 9px 0;
-    text-align: center;
-    font-size: 75%;
-}
-
-div.footer a {
-    color: {{ theme_footertextcolor }};
-    text-decoration: underline;
-}
-
-div.related {
-    background-color: {{ theme_relbarbgcolor }};
-    line-height: 30px;
-    color: {{ theme_relbartextcolor }};
-}
-
-div.related a {
-    color: {{ theme_relbarlinkcolor }};
-}
-
-div.sphinxsidebar {
-    {%- if theme_stickysidebar|tobool %}
-    top: 30px;
-    margin: 0;
-    position: fixed;
-    overflow: auto;
-    height: 100%;
-    {%- endif %}
-    {%- if theme_rightsidebar|tobool %}
-    float: right;
-    {%- if theme_stickysidebar|tobool %}
-    right: 0;
-    {%- endif %}
-    {%- endif %}
-}
-
-{%- if theme_stickysidebar|tobool %}
-/* this is nice, but it it leads to hidden headings when jumping
-   to an anchor */
-/*
-div.related {
-    position: fixed;
-}
-
-div.documentwrapper {
-    margin-top: 30px;
-}
-*/
-{%- endif %}
-
-div.sphinxsidebar h3 {
-    font-family: {{ theme_headfont }};
-    color: {{ theme_sidebartextcolor }};
-    font-size: 1.4em;
-    font-weight: normal;
-    margin: 0;
-    padding: 0;
-}
-
-div.sphinxsidebar h3 a {
-    color: {{ theme_sidebartextcolor }};
-}
-
-div.sphinxsidebar h4 {
-    font-family: {{ theme_headfont }};
-    color: {{ theme_sidebartextcolor }};
-    font-size: 1.3em;
-    font-weight: normal;
-    margin: 5px 0 0 0;
-    padding: 0;
-}
-
-div.sphinxsidebar p {
-    color: {{ theme_sidebartextcolor }};
-}
-
-div.sphinxsidebar p.topless {
-    margin: 5px 10px 10px 10px;
-}
-
-div.sphinxsidebar ul {
-    margin: 10px;
-    padding: 0;
-    color: {{ theme_sidebartextcolor }};
-}
-
-div.sphinxsidebar a {
-    color: {{ theme_sidebarlinkcolor }};
-}
-
-div.sphinxsidebar input {
-    border: 1px solid {{ theme_sidebarlinkcolor }};
-    font-family: sans-serif;
-    font-size: 1em;
-}
-
-/* -- body styles ----------------------------------------------------------- */
-
-a {
-    color: {{ theme_linkcolor }};
-    text-decoration: none;
-}
-
-a:hover {
-    text-decoration: underline;
-}
-
-div.body p, div.body dd, div.body li {
-    text-align: justify;
-    line-height: 130%;
-}
-
-div.body h1,
-div.body h2,
-div.body h3,
-div.body h4,
-div.body h5,
-div.body h6 {
-    font-family: {{ theme_headfont }};
-    background-color: {{ theme_headbgcolor }};
-    font-weight: normal;
-    color: {{ theme_headtextcolor }};
-    border-bottom: 1px solid #ccc;
-    margin: 20px -20px 10px -20px;
-    padding: 3px 0 3px 10px;
-}
-
-div.body h1 { margin-top: 0; font-size: 200%; }
-div.body h2 { font-size: 160%; }
-div.body h3 { font-size: 140%; }
-div.body h4 { font-size: 120%; }
-div.body h5 { font-size: 110%; }
-div.body h6 { font-size: 100%; }
-
-a.headerlink {
-    color: {{ theme_headlinkcolor }};
-    font-size: 0.8em;
-    padding: 0 4px 0 4px;
-    text-decoration: none;
-}
-
-a.headerlink:hover {
-    background-color: {{ theme_headlinkcolor }};
-    color: white;
-}
-
-div.body p, div.body dd, div.body li {
-    text-align: justify;
-    line-height: 130%;
-}
-
-div.admonition p.admonition-title + p {
-    display: inline;
-}
-
-div.note {
-    background-color: #eee;
-    border: 1px solid #ccc;
-}
-
-div.seealso {
-    background-color: #ffc;
-    border: 1px solid #ff6;
-}
-
-div.topic {
-    background-color: #eee;
-}
-
-div.warning {
-    background-color: #ffe4e4;
-    border: 1px solid #f66;
-}
-
-p.admonition-title {
-    display: inline;
-}
-
-p.admonition-title:after {
-    content: ":";
-}
-
-pre {
-    padding: 5px;
-    background-color: {{ theme_codebgcolor }};
-    color: {{ theme_codetextcolor }};
-    line-height: 120%;
-    border: 1px solid #ac9;
-    border-left: none;
-    border-right: none;
-}
-
-tt {
-    background-color: #ecf0f3;
-    padding: 0 1px 0 1px;
-    font-size: 0.95em;
-}
-
-div.mainbody {
-  background-color: #ffffff;
-  color: #000000;
-  padding: 0 20px 30px 20px;
-  background-image: url(grad1.jpg);
-  background-repeat: repeat-x;
-}
-
-div.maintitle { 
-  padding-top: 15px;
-  font-size: 29px;
-  text-align: center;
-  font-weight: bold;
-}
-
-div.maindescription {
-  font-size: 19px;
-  font-weight: bold;
-}
-
-div.maindescription p {
-  text-align: center;
-  color: gray;
-}
-
-ul.mainlinks {
-  margin: 0;
-  list-style-type: none;
-}
-
-ul.mainlinks li {
-  display: inline;
-}
-
-ul.mainlinks li a {
-  float: left;
-  padding: 15px;
-  text-decoration: none;
-}
-
-ul.mainlinks li a span {
-    display: block;
-    text-align: center;
-}
-
-ul.mainlinks li a span.linktitle {
-    font-size: 22px;
-    font-weight: bold;
-    padding-bottom: 15px;
-}
-
-ul.mainlinks li a span.linkdesc {
-    font-size: 10px;
-    display: block;
-    padding-top: 10px;
-}
-
-div.testimonials {
-  margin: 0 auto;
-  width: 690px;
-  text-align: center;
-}
-
-.creatorandusers { 
-  margin: 40px auto 0;
-  width: 710px;
-}
-
-.sectiontitle { 
-  float: left;
-  text-align: right;
-  width: 200px;
-  font-size: 24px;
-}
-
-.sectioncontent { 
-  float: right;
-  width: 460px;
-  font-size: 18px;
-  line-height: 140%;
-}
-
-.sectionlogos { 
-  margin: 10px auto 0;
-  width: 410px;
-}
-
-.sectionlogos a {
-  padding: 10px;
-}
-
-/* AVAILABLE-COLORS
- * The set of colors understood by docutils.
- */
-
-.maroon  { color: maroon; }
-.red     { color: red; }
-.magenta { color: magenta; }
-.fuchsia { color: fuchsia; }
-.pink    { color: #FAA; }
-.orange  { color: orange; }
-.yellow  { color: yellow; }
-.lime    { color: lime; }
-.green   { color: green; }
-.olive   { color: olive; }
-.teal    { color: teal; }
-.cyan    { color: cyan; }
-.aqua    { color: aqua; }
-.blue    { color: blue; }
-.navy    { color: navy; }
-.purple  { color: purple; }
-.black   { color: black; }
-.gray    { color: gray; }
-.silver  { color: silver; }
-.white   { color: white; }
-

Copied: buildout-website/trunk/source/buildout_theme2/static/buildout.css_t (from rev 99429, buildout-website/trunk/source/_static/default.css_t)
===================================================================
--- buildout-website/trunk/source/buildout_theme2/static/buildout.css_t	                        (rev 0)
+++ buildout-website/trunk/source/buildout_theme2/static/buildout.css_t	2009-04-23 18:17:05 UTC (rev 99433)
@@ -0,0 +1,351 @@
+/**
+ * Sphinx stylesheet -- default theme
+ * 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
+ */
+
+ at import url("basic.css");
+
+/* -- page layout ----------------------------------------------------------- */
+
+body {
+    font-family: {{ theme_bodyfont }};
+    font-size: 100%;
+    background-color: {{ theme_footerbgcolor }};
+    color: #000;
+    margin: 0;
+    padding: 0;
+}
+
+div.document {
+    background-color: {{ theme_sidebarbgcolor }};
+}
+
+div.body {
+    background-color: {{ theme_bgcolor }};
+    color: {{ theme_textcolor }};
+    padding: 0 20px 30px 20px;
+}
+
+{%- if theme_rightsidebar|tobool %}
+div.bodywrapper {
+    margin: 0 230px 0 0;
+}
+{%- endif %}
+
+div.footer {
+    color: {{ theme_footertextcolor }};
+    width: 100%;
+    padding: 9px 0 9px 0;
+    text-align: center;
+    font-size: 75%;
+}
+
+div.footer a {
+    color: {{ theme_footertextcolor }};
+    text-decoration: underline;
+}
+
+div.related {
+    background-color: {{ theme_relbarbgcolor }};
+    line-height: 30px;
+    color: {{ theme_relbartextcolor }};
+}
+
+div.related a {
+    color: {{ theme_relbarlinkcolor }};
+}
+
+div.sphinxsidebar {
+    {%- if theme_stickysidebar|tobool %}
+    top: 30px;
+    margin: 0;
+    position: fixed;
+    overflow: auto;
+    height: 100%;
+    {%- endif %}
+    {%- if theme_rightsidebar|tobool %}
+    float: right;
+    {%- if theme_stickysidebar|tobool %}
+    right: 0;
+    {%- endif %}
+    {%- endif %}
+}
+
+{%- if theme_stickysidebar|tobool %}
+/* this is nice, but it it leads to hidden headings when jumping
+   to an anchor */
+/*
+div.related {
+    position: fixed;
+}
+
+div.documentwrapper {
+    margin-top: 30px;
+}
+*/
+{%- endif %}
+
+div.sphinxsidebar h3 {
+    font-family: {{ theme_headfont }};
+    color: {{ theme_sidebartextcolor }};
+    font-size: 1.4em;
+    font-weight: normal;
+    margin: 0;
+    padding: 0;
+}
+
+div.sphinxsidebar h3 a {
+    color: {{ theme_sidebartextcolor }};
+}
+
+div.sphinxsidebar h4 {
+    font-family: {{ theme_headfont }};
+    color: {{ theme_sidebartextcolor }};
+    font-size: 1.3em;
+    font-weight: normal;
+    margin: 5px 0 0 0;
+    padding: 0;
+}
+
+div.sphinxsidebar p {
+    color: {{ theme_sidebartextcolor }};
+}
+
+div.sphinxsidebar p.topless {
+    margin: 5px 10px 10px 10px;
+}
+
+div.sphinxsidebar ul {
+    margin: 10px;
+    padding: 0;
+    color: {{ theme_sidebartextcolor }};
+}
+
+div.sphinxsidebar a {
+    color: {{ theme_sidebarlinkcolor }};
+}
+
+div.sphinxsidebar input {
+    border: 1px solid {{ theme_sidebarlinkcolor }};
+    font-family: sans-serif;
+    font-size: 1em;
+}
+
+/* -- body styles ----------------------------------------------------------- */
+
+a {
+    color: {{ theme_linkcolor }};
+    text-decoration: none;
+}
+
+a:hover {
+    text-decoration: underline;
+}
+
+div.body p, div.body dd, div.body li {
+    text-align: justify;
+    line-height: 130%;
+}
+
+div.body h1,
+div.body h2,
+div.body h3,
+div.body h4,
+div.body h5,
+div.body h6 {
+    font-family: {{ theme_headfont }};
+    background-color: {{ theme_headbgcolor }};
+    font-weight: normal;
+    color: {{ theme_headtextcolor }};
+    border-bottom: 1px solid #ccc;
+    margin: 20px -20px 10px -20px;
+    padding: 3px 0 3px 10px;
+}
+
+div.body h1 { margin-top: 0; font-size: 200%; }
+div.body h2 { font-size: 160%; }
+div.body h3 { font-size: 140%; }
+div.body h4 { font-size: 120%; }
+div.body h5 { font-size: 110%; }
+div.body h6 { font-size: 100%; }
+
+a.headerlink {
+    color: {{ theme_headlinkcolor }};
+    font-size: 0.8em;
+    padding: 0 4px 0 4px;
+    text-decoration: none;
+}
+
+a.headerlink:hover {
+    background-color: {{ theme_headlinkcolor }};
+    color: white;
+}
+
+div.body p, div.body dd, div.body li {
+    text-align: justify;
+    line-height: 130%;
+}
+
+div.admonition p.admonition-title + p {
+    display: inline;
+}
+
+div.note {
+    background-color: #eee;
+    border: 1px solid #ccc;
+}
+
+div.seealso {
+    background-color: #ffc;
+    border: 1px solid #ff6;
+}
+
+div.topic {
+    background-color: #eee;
+}
+
+div.warning {
+    background-color: #ffe4e4;
+    border: 1px solid #f66;
+}
+
+p.admonition-title {
+    display: inline;
+}
+
+p.admonition-title:after {
+    content: ":";
+}
+
+pre {
+    padding: 5px;
+    background-color: {{ theme_codebgcolor }};
+    color: {{ theme_codetextcolor }};
+    line-height: 120%;
+    border: 1px solid #ac9;
+    border-left: none;
+    border-right: none;
+}
+
+tt {
+    background-color: #ecf0f3;
+    padding: 0 1px 0 1px;
+    font-size: 0.95em;
+}
+
+div.mainbody {
+  background-color: #ffffff;
+  color: #000000;
+  padding: 0 20px 30px 20px;
+  background-image: url(grad1.jpg);
+  background-repeat: repeat-x;
+}
+
+div.maintitle { 
+  padding-top: 15px;
+  font-size: 29px;
+  text-align: center;
+  font-weight: bold;
+}
+
+div.maindescription {
+  font-size: 19px;
+  font-weight: bold;
+}
+
+div.maindescription p {
+  text-align: center;
+  color: gray;
+}
+
+ul.mainlinks {
+  margin: 0;
+  list-style-type: none;
+}
+
+ul.mainlinks li {
+  display: inline;
+}
+
+ul.mainlinks li a {
+  float: left;
+  padding: 15px;
+  text-decoration: none;
+}
+
+ul.mainlinks li a span {
+    display: block;
+    text-align: center;
+}
+
+ul.mainlinks li a span.linktitle {
+    font-size: 22px;
+    font-weight: bold;
+    padding-bottom: 15px;
+}
+
+ul.mainlinks li a span.linkdesc {
+    font-size: 10px;
+    display: block;
+    padding-top: 10px;
+}
+
+div.testimonials {
+  margin: 0 auto;
+  width: 690px;
+  text-align: center;
+}
+
+.creatorandusers { 
+  margin: 40px auto 0;
+  width: 710px;
+}
+
+.sectiontitle { 
+  float: left;
+  text-align: right;
+  width: 200px;
+  font-size: 24px;
+}
+
+.sectioncontent { 
+  float: right;
+  width: 460px;
+  font-size: 18px;
+  line-height: 140%;
+}
+
+.sectionlogos { 
+  margin: 10px auto 0;
+  width: 410px;
+}
+
+.sectionlogos a {
+  padding: 10px;
+}
+
+/* AVAILABLE-COLORS
+ * The set of colors understood by docutils.
+ */
+
+.maroon  { color: maroon; }
+.red     { color: red; }
+.magenta { color: magenta; }
+.fuchsia { color: fuchsia; }
+.pink    { color: #FAA; }
+.orange  { color: orange; }
+.yellow  { color: yellow; }
+.lime    { color: lime; }
+.green   { color: green; }
+.olive   { color: olive; }
+.teal    { color: teal; }
+.cyan    { color: cyan; }
+.aqua    { color: aqua; }
+.blue    { color: blue; }
+.navy    { color: navy; }
+.purple  { color: purple; }
+.black   { color: black; }
+.gray    { color: gray; }
+.silver  { color: silver; }
+.white   { color: white; }
+

Added: buildout-website/trunk/source/buildout_theme2/theme.conf
===================================================================
--- buildout-website/trunk/source/buildout_theme2/theme.conf	                        (rev 0)
+++ buildout-website/trunk/source/buildout_theme2/theme.conf	2009-04-23 18:17:05 UTC (rev 99433)
@@ -0,0 +1,28 @@
+[theme]
+inherit = basic
+stylesheet = buildout.css
+pygments_style = sphinx
+
+[options]
+rightsidebar = false
+stickysidebar = false
+
+footerbgcolor    = #11303d
+footertextcolor  = #ffffff
+sidebarbgcolor   = #1c4e63
+sidebartextcolor = #ffffff
+sidebarlinkcolor = #98dbcc
+relbarbgcolor    = #133f52
+relbartextcolor  = #ffffff
+relbarlinkcolor  = #ffffff
+bgcolor          = #ffffff
+textcolor        = #000000
+headbgcolor      = #f2f2f2
+headtextcolor    = #20435c
+headlinkcolor    = #c60f0f
+linkcolor        = #355f7c
+codebgcolor      = #eeffcc
+codetextcolor    = #333333
+
+bodyfont = sans-serif
+headfont = 'Trebuchet MS', sans-serif



More information about the Checkins mailing list